Web(August 2024) Olivine basalt collected from the rim of Hadley Rille by the crew of Apollo 15 Moon rock or lunar rock is rock originating from Earth's Moon. This includes lunar material collected during the course of human exploration of the Moon, and rock that has been ejected naturally from the Moon's surface and landed on Earth as meteorites . Learn about the … mnr hunt and fishWebThe basalt is simply washed and then melted. [4] The manufacture of basalt fiber requires the melting of the crushed and washed basalt rock at about 1,500 °C (2,730 °F).
